Transaction 3708ae2684b053d5cf110bca59a344f32fbe621bb7b34b1c6f8e04e7846af5ee
1 Input
1 Output
-
3708ae2684b053d5cf110bca59a344f32fbe621bb7b34b1c6f8e04e7846af5ee:0
- value
- 1140358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 32848572046b89d9781a82384e563f3269e889bc OP_EQUAL
- address
- 36J8TsgS4sK3zLWrmHHxuHHuuENUEGygrh